Leadership Lab is a gamified Christian Leadership experiment for high school students in the Great Plains Conference. High school students engage in a web of relationships, resourcing, and experiences that culminate in eligibility for a triennial trip to the Holy Land with other students, their mentors, and the key conference leaders. Eligibility is determined by completing the Leadership Lab curriculum.
Requirements for Leadership Lab
High school student
Active member in local United Methodist Church
Sponsored by a leader in their local church - Student must invite mentor to serve in this capacity prior to application
Completed the application process
Commitment to attending:
Annual Opening Retreat (first weekend in August; location TBD; planning for in-person, reserve the right to pivot to virtual if necessary)
Annual Conference Gathering (date and location TBD; typically end of May/early June)
Quarterly Regional Team meetings (dates and location TBD together with teammates)
Regular meetings with local mentor (dates and location TBD together with mentor)
Commitment to complete Leadership Lab curriculum
